Barcelona’s Lamine Yamal set to break Champions League record with goal against Young Boys

Barcelona wonderkid Lamine Yamal could be on the verge of making UEFA Champions League history when Barcelona face Young Boys at the Camp Nou, Soccernet.football reports.

The 17-year-old forward, already regarded as one of football’s brightest talents, has dazzled since his rapid rise from La Masia to the first team, breaking numerous records along the way.

Yamal’s performances this season have been nothing short of remarkable. With five goals and five assists in just nine matches across all competitions, he has quickly established himself as a key player for Hansi Flick’s Barcelona side.

The teenager’s poise, skill, and maturity on the field have even drawn praise from global football icons, including Cristiano Ronaldo, who tipped him as a future Ballon d’Or contender.

Tonight, Yamal has the opportunity to add another milestone to his growing list of achievements.

If he scores against Young Boys, he will become the first player under the age of 18 to score in consecutive Champions League matches.

The current record for the youngest scorer in the competition is held by his teammate Ansu Fati, who netted at 17 years and 40 days.

Yamal, who scored his first Champions League goal last month against AS Monaco at 17 years and 68 days, narrowly missed out on surpassing Fati’s record.

With Barcelona heavily favoured in the match against Young Boys, and Yamal in excellent form, history may be just 90 minutes away for the teenage sensation.

All eyes will be on him as he seeks to cement his place in Champions League lore with another stunning performance.
